Key Responsibilities:
- The main warehouse situated is leased from a third party and the relationship with the landlord is not firmly established. The operation is reaching economic capacity in terms of the number of available pick bays as the range of SKU’s continues to increase. A cost effective and implementable “Masterplan” or expansion plan needs to be formulated, developed, agreed and implemented within the next three to four years.
- Fire protection and avoidance. This is a critical risk as all finished product stock (circa 4 weeks and 1400 SKU’s) is held in the facility. A full risk analysis carried out and remedial actions implemented.
- The delivery drivers are the “First Face” of our client and often they are the only company representative many of our customers see on a daily/weekly basis. However, recruitment is proving difficult despite competitive remuneration packages and a strong plan to attract, develop and retain the right talent is required.
- Both the number and types of customers are evolving and this has led to an increase in SKU’s. A short to medium term solution is required to guarantee capacity and maintain cost efficiency.
- There is a great workforce which is strongly motivated and performs well on a daily basis. However, the trust and mutual partnership between the workforce and managers is an area that would benefit from strong leadership and would be a key focus in this role.
- Hitting budget through continuous focus on identifying opportunities and implementing reductions in operational cost to minimise distribution and warehouse cost as a percentage of sales.
